Our Client is hiring a Full Stack Software Developer for a long-term onsite contract opportunity. The ideal candidate will have strong experience in SharePoint Online, Power Platform, .NET technologies, SQL Server, and modern web development frameworks.
This role involves developing and supporting enterprise applications, enhancing SharePoint platforms, building scalable APIs and integrations, troubleshooting technical issues, and contributing throughout the Software Development Life Cycle (SDLC).
Key Responsibilities
Application Development & Full Stack Engineering
Design, develop, test, and maintain scalable full stack applications
Build and enhance data pipelines involving extraction, transformation, and loading (ETL)
Translate technical specifications into fully functional, tested applications
Develop reusable, maintainable, and scalable front end and back end components
Design and integrate REST APIs and front end interfaces
SharePoint & Power Platform Support
Support and enhance SharePoint Online websites and applications
Work on Power Apps, Power Automate, Dataverse, and infrastructure sustainment activities
Assist with SharePoint upgrades, migrations, releases, and troubleshooting
Web & API Development
Develop responsive web interfaces using HTML, CSS, JavaScript, AngularJS, and related technologies
Ensure front end applications integrate effectively with APIs and backend services
Build accessible and user-friendly applications following AODA standards
Database & Backend Development
Work with SQL Server, Oracle databases, and web application technologies
Support Java-based web applications including WebLogic, Tomcat, Servlets, and EJB
Participate in database design, optimization, troubleshooting, and deployment activities
Collaboration & Delivery
Work closely with business stakeholders, project teams, and technical teams
Participate in Agile/Scrum ceremonies using Azure DevOps and JIRA
Conduct unit testing, debugging, code reviews, and technical documentation
Provide post implementation support and issue resolution
Required Skills
Technical Skills
Microsoft SharePoint Online
Power Apps
Power Automate
Dataverse
Azure Fundamentals
C#
.NET Framework
SQL Server
HTML, CSS, JavaScript
Angular / AngularJS
RESTful APIs
API Integration
Data Migration
Accessibility Compliance (AODA)
Development & Tools
Azure DevOps
JIRA
Agile / Scrum Methodologies
CI/CD Concepts
Web Architecture & Full Stack Development
Database Design & Management
Additional Technologies
Java WebLogic
Tomcat
EJB
Servlets
SOAP & REST Web Services
Oracle Database
Preferred Experience
Experience supporting public sector or government clients
Experience working with ministry or agency environments
Strong troubleshooting and problem solving skills
Experience creating accessible enterprise applications
Experience maintaining and enhancing SharePoint environments
By continuing you agree to our Terms & Privacy Policy.